Shareholder Votes

CS Disco, Inc. shareholders approved Ratification of the selection of Ernst & Young LLP as independent registered public accounting firm for fiscal year ending December 31, 2023 at the 2023-06-15 meeting.

“The Company’s stockholders ratified the selection by the Audit Committee of the Company’s Board of Directors of Ernst & Young LLP as the independent registered public accounting firm of the Company for its fiscal year ending December 31, 2023. The final voting results are as follows: Votes For Votes Against Abstentions 55,998,334 15,130 6,951”
Shareholder Votes

CS Disco, Inc. shareholders approved Election of three Class II directors at the 2023-06-15 meeting.

“The Company’s stockholders elected the three persons listed below as Class II directors, each to hold office until the Company’s 2026 Annual Meeting of Stockholders and until their respective successors are duly elected and qualified, or, if sooner, such director’s death, resignation or removal. The final voting results are as follows: Nominee Votes For Votes Withheld Broker Non-Votes Colette Pierce Burnette, Ed.D. 48,356,227 2,011,517 5,652,671 Aaron Clark 45,407,962 4,959,782 5,652,671 James Offerdahl 50,249,405 118,339 5,652,671”

Earnings Releases

CS Disco, Inc. reported the fiscal year ended December 31, 2022 results: revenue $135.2 million, net income $70.8 million net loss.

“Fiscal Year 2022 Financial Highlights: • Total revenue was $135.2 million, up 18% compared to fiscal year 2021. • GAAP net loss was $70.8 million, compared to $24.3 million in fiscal year 2021.”
Earnings Releases

CS Disco, Inc. reported the fourth quarter ended December 31, 2022 results: revenue $32.5 million, net income $18.7 million net loss.

“Fourth Quarter 2022 Financial Highlights: • Total revenue was $32.5 million, down 4% compared to the fourth quarter of 2021. • GAAP net loss was $18.7 million, compared to $9.1 million in the fourth quarter of 2021.”

Restructurings & Charges

CS Disco, Inc. announced a restructuring with charges of approximately $0.9 million to $1.1 million (approximately 62 employees, representing approximately 9% of the Company’s current global workforce).

“intended to reduce the Company’s cost structure and accelerate its path to profitability. The Company estimates that it will incur non-recurring charges of approximately $0.9 million to $1.1 million in connection with the Plan, consisting of cash expenditures primarily for employee severance and other termination benefits.
